The World - News from Oct. 11, 1988
Emperor Hirohito sent his thanks to the millions of Japanese who have offered prayers since he fell ill with intestinal bleeding. “Please convey my gratitude,” Hirohito was quoted as telling Imperial Household Agency chief Shoichi Fujimori, who visited the 87-year-old monarch. The agency said over 1.3 million well-wishers have signed registries praying for the emperor’s recovery.
